Why does my arc fault breaker keep tripping in my Axtell home, and can you fix it?
Arc fault breaker trips are common in older Axtell homes, often caused by worn wiring, faulty appliances, or outdated circuits. Cornerstone Electric performs a thorough electric inspection to pinpoint the exact cause—whether it's in a light fixture, an outlet, or the wiring itself. We then provide the necessary repair or replacement to stop the nuisance trips and ensure your home's safety.
How can I tell if my home's grounding system is improper or unsafe?
Signs of an improper grounding system include frequent electrical shocks from appliances, buzzing outlets, or circuits that don't work correctly. As your local electrician, Cornerstone Electric offers expert electric inspection services to test your home's grounding. We can identify issues and perform the precise installation or repair needed to bring your system up to safe, current code standards for Axtell.
Can you install new light fixtures if my home has older, problematic wiring?
Absolutely. Installing new light fixtures on outdated wiring can be a safety hazard. Before any installation, our electricians will assess the existing circuit and junction box. We often handle the necessary wiring repair or replacement as part of the job, ensuring your new fixture is not only beautiful but also safely and properly integrated into your home's electrical system.
